Some of you may have read about my quest to relive my youth and ride the VFR750 I wanted when I was 21, only to discover I don't fit on the damn thing!

So the hunt was on for something else; another XJ650 would've been nice, but I couldn't find a decent one, then the dealer selling the CBX750 I really fancied, didn't so much turn down the offer I made for it, as completely fail to acknowledge I'd even made it.

Then I saw this, stuck in some bids, but it failed to make reserve; a phone call later and the seller accepted my offer, so I was on the train to Coventry this morning.

https://img4.imageshack.us/img4/7249/1lxr.jpg

https://img707.imageshack.us/img707/263/a8jv.jpg

1983 Suzuki GS650GX Katana, lovely shaft drive, loads of history and an entirely believable 18K on the clock.

Best of all, I fit on it!

Front brakes are pretty awful, despite a recent caliper overhaul, so I'm reckoning a new hose kit is on the cards; also the scaffolding on the back looks totally out of place, so a more stylish luggage solution will be investigated.

Wow nice looking example! Watch out for dogs going in 2nd if used hard and cam problems if you don't keep the oil changed regular! Latter is not an issue if used with modern synthetic oil! Wink also had a shaft snap on mine!

Funny you should mention the gearbox, first to second is a much longer throw than any of the other gears and, if you rush it and aren't really positive, there is a false neutral to be found.

Having said that, I had a couple of GS550s from new and they were the same, so I figured it might be a Suzuki quirk.
